A state of a solution or compound in which it is a gaseous suspension of very fine solid or liquid particles. Aerosol comes from the longer term 'aero-solution' meaning, quite obviously, a solution mixed with air.

Most aerosol prodcts come in the now familiar 'can' form, the liquid contents inside being under pressure from compressed gasses held in the container with them. When a valve on the container is opened, the compressed gasses inside the can push the liquid out at a high rate of speed such as they turn into a mist, and thus are aerosol, or 'mixed with air'.
